产品设计中为什么要重视反馈?
首先要说明,这里的“反馈”不是意见反馈之类的东西,而是产品本身的反馈机制。
如果我们向产品设计人员提问:产品的反馈重要吗?我想没有任何一个人会说反馈不重要。如果问到:反馈为什么重要?可能多数产品设计人员也能回答的头头是道,比如:没有反馈,用户便不清楚自己的操作是否得当,不知道接下来改怎么办。没有反馈,用户会无法完成任务。没有反馈,用户会懊恼、慌张、埋怨自己笨等等。但这些只是表象。知道这些原因并不能让我们设计出好的反馈。
那么,什么是我们必须要做好反馈的深层次原因呢?最近看了《设计心理学》这本书,里面所讲的“采取行动的七个阶段”是我目前看到的最好的解释了。
诺曼认为,个体采取行动包括七个阶段,即:
- 目标:确定自己所要达成的目标。
- 行动意图:由于目标的确定,个体会产生行动的意图或意向,也就是要做点什么的意愿。
- 动作顺序:本质上是行动的步骤或操作的流程。
- 执行:个体按照动作顺序行动或操作。
- 感知外部世界状况:在个体执行操作后,会通过视觉、嗅觉、听觉、动觉等来感知行动所作用的外部世界的状况。
- 解释外部世界状况:在个体感知到外部状况后,个体会有意识或下意识地对这些状况进行解释,即外部状况发生的事情是什么意思。
- 评估行动结果:在对外部状况进行解释,知道外部世界发生了什么后,个体会判断这些发生的状况是否是自己想要的,即是否达到了自己的目标。
比如:我们在视频APP上看视频,想要把这个视频下载下来。那么,七个步骤可能是:
- 目标:下载某一个视频。
- 行动意图:准备好现在就去下载。
- 动作顺序:找到相应视频,找到下载按钮,点击下载按钮。
- 执行:按照动作顺序执行,点击下载按钮。
- 感知外部世界状况:看到“下载”按钮变为“取消下载”按钮,看到下载进度条出现。
- 解释外部世界状况:“取消下载”出现表示下载生效,“进度条进度在走”表示已经进行到某个阶段。
- 评估行动结果:当下载完成后,系统提示“下载完成,可到个人中心-我的下载中查看”,查看后确认自己的目标达成。
从这七个步骤来看,前三步是个体行为的启动,从第四步行为开始执行时,就是与外界开始交互时,这时候就需要反馈起作用。只有有了反馈,用户才能够感知外部世界状况,进而解释外部世界状况,从而评估行动结果。没有反馈,步骤5、6、7将无法进行下去。这也是反馈如此重要的根本性原因。
那么,怎样才能设计一个优秀的反馈呢。从上面的步骤来看,一个好的反馈至少要做到以下几点:
- 对用户的每一个操作或行为进行反馈。这里涉及到对用户行为或操作的拆解,部分时候甚至需要重构流程,以符合用户的行为习惯(动作顺序)。
- 反馈要明确,容易被个体感知。用户无法感知到的或无法明确感知的反馈,会增加用户的感知和识别成本,让人困惑。故,有时候需要多种反馈手段同时进行,而不能贪图简介只提供一种反馈。
- 反馈要及时。这一点不多说,想想你点击一个下载按钮没反应时的感觉吧。
- 反馈要符合个体的认知水平,即能让用户理解。举一个极端的例子:一个中文网站,反馈用阿拉伯文,反馈做的再好,用户也看不懂。也就无法解释这个系统到底发生了什么事情。
- 反馈最好能够引导用户进行下一步操作。比如:当提示用户下载视频成功后,可以引导用户去视频下载区查看,让用户知道以后找下载视频去哪儿找。虽然提示成功其实也已经能够让用户评估自己是否达成目标,但进一步的引导会让体验更好。
最后说说反馈的形式。可以说,用户操作后,系统的任何变化都可以作为反馈。比如:新开一个页面、当前页面内容的变化、弹出框、提示框、鼠标悬停时状态的变化、声音、进度条等等。即:能向用户提供信息,使用户知道某一操作是否已经完成的变化,都可以作为反馈。
反馈,是人机交互的基础。没有反馈,就没有交互。
#专栏作家#
岳山丘,微信公众号:iamyueshanqiu,人人都是产品经理专栏作家,慕课网产品经理。兜兜转转好多年,一直在教育行业做产品。初始做内容,后来开始做WEB端。关注在线教育、互联网金融(顺便赚点小钱花)。最近一段时间开始研究移动APP产品,希望能够多学习一些东西。
本文原创发布于人人都是产品经理,未经许可,不得转载。
🙄